Lua error in Module:Infobox at line 235: malformed pattern (missing ']'). Miguel Emilio Almonte (born April 4, 1993) is a Dominican professional baseball pitcher for the Kansas City Royals of Major League Baseball (MLB).

Almonte made his professional debut with the Dominican Summer League Royals in 2011. In 2013 he pitched for the World Team at the 2013 All-Star Futures Game.[1][2] He finished the 2013 season with a 3.10 earned run average and 132 strikeouts in ​130 23 innings. Although the Royals considered starting him in Double A, he started the 2014 season with the High-A Wilmington Blue Rocks.[3][4]
